Birmingham International prides itself on its customer-centric amenities designed for convenience and comfort. The ticket office operates from early morning until late night, with machines readily available for ticket collection, including those for accessible use. While smartcards can be validated here, they are not issued at this station. Assistance is a priority with help points located throughout the station and staff available to assist from early morning until late at night, every day except Christmas and Boxing Day.
Accessibility is at the forefront, with step-free access available across all platforms. For those needing extra support, wheelchair access and ramps for train access are provided. Waiting areas are generously equipped with seating and there are accessible toilets, including a Changing Places facility. Car parking is ample, featuring 2124 parking spaces, with 24 designated for accessible parking, and is monitored around the clock.
For those needing to grab a bite or do some quick shopping, Birmingham International provides several refreshment and shopping facilities to cater to your needs. Although there are no ATMs, Wi-Fi is readily accessible, ensuring that you stay connected while waiting for your train. Additionally, cyclists can take advantage of secure bicycle storage and even hire a Brompton bike if needed.
One of Birmingham International's key advantages is its exceptional transport links. It connects directly with Birmingham Airport via the 'Air-Rail Link,' a free two-minute people mover operating extensively from early morning to just past midnight. For those traveling by bus or taxi, services are conveniently situated outside the station entrance. Detailed information and printable timetables for bus travel can be found here. Rail replacement services are also organized efficiently from the front of the station.

Crowhurst Station may be small, but it serves the needs of its passengers efficiently. The station's ticket office operates from 06:00 to 10:00 on weekdays, with automatic mach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ets both online and at the station. Do note that smartcards are not issued or validated here, although traditional paper tickets are fully supported.
Facilities for those requiring assistance are thoughtfully provided. While full step-free access isn't available, platform 1 does offer it for those heading towards London, complete with accessible ticket machines stationed there. A help point is available for any on-the-go assistance, and station staff are present during ticket office hours to aid where necessary. CCTV is operational for enhanced security, bringing peace of mind to passengers awaiting trains. The station holds a Secure Station accreditation, demonstrating its commitment to passenger safety and security.
